Notes

Licensed from Rough Trade Records.
Japanese release that contains both albums.
Includes a booklet with the lyrics and their Japanese translation.

1-1 to 1-10: The Queen Is Dead (27JC-191)
Recorded in England, Winter 1985.
Orchestration by The Hated Salford Ensemble.
String arrangements by Johnny Marr.
Sleeve by Morrissey.
Cover star Alain Delon.

2-1 to 2-16: Hatful Of Hollow (27JC-192)
Taken from the BBC Radio One John Peel show : tracks 2, 4, 6, 8, 10, 14, 15.
Taken from the BBC Radio One David Jensen show : tracks 3, 11, 12.
